Bulls Say, Bears Say
Bulls Say
Strong Cash GenerationMaterial operating cash flow (~$13.5B guidance) and rising free cash flow provide durable internal funding for capex on smoke-free platforms, dividends and targeted investments. Over the next 2–6 months this underpins strategic flexibility to sustain product rollouts and margin initiatives.
Smoke-free Market LeadershipHigh global share for IQOS and ongoing smoke‑free shipment growth create a durable competitive moat: recurring consumable sales, strong brand recognition and scale in R&D/commercial rollout support pricing, cross‑sell and higher lifetime value of users for 2–6+ months and beyond.
Margin Expansion And Sustained Cost SavingsSignificant gross cost savings and demonstrated gross‑margin expansion (high segment margins noted) indicate durable operational leverage. These structural cost efficiencies support sustained operating margin improvement and cash conversion as the company scales smoke‑free consumables and manages global manufacturing.
Bears Say
Aggressive Capital StructureNegative equity and a large, rising debt stock are lasting constraints on financial flexibility. Even with strong cash flows, operating cash covers less than half of total debt, increasing refinancing and interest‑rate risk and limiting the company’s ability to accelerate deleveraging within a multi‑month horizon.
Regulatory / Excise Volatility In Key MarketsRegulatory moves (flavor bans) and excise changes are structural risks that alter addressable markets and product economics. They can persist for months, force reformulation or distribution changes, and materially affect consumable volumes and pricing power in affected geographies over the medium term.
U.S. Pouch Competitive PressureIntense competition and product/strength gaps in the U.S. pouch market threaten a key growth channel. Management’s need for stepped‑up investment to address mix and strength segments implies sustained marketing spend and execution risk, which can limit U.S. margin and share gains over the next several quarters.

Company Description
Philip Morris International
Philip Morris International Inc. functions as a prominent tobacco enterprise, actively working toward a smoke-free future. The company is strategically diversifying its long-term product range to incorporate items beyond traditional tobacco and nicotine. Its primary business involves both conventional cigarettes and an expanding array of smoke-free alternatives, such as innovative heat-not-burn devices, vapor products, and oral nicotine solutions. These offerings are distributed in markets worldwide, with the exception of the United States. The smoke-free portfolio includes brands like HEETS (encompassing Creations, Dimensions, Marlboro variants), Parliament HeatSticks, and TEREA, in addition to KT&G-licensed brands Fiit and Miix. For conventional cigarettes, the company sells internationally recognized brands such as Marlboro, Parliament, Bond Street, Chesterfield, L&M, Lark, and Philip Morris. Regionally, it also owns major cigarette brands like Dji Sam Soe, Sampoerna A, and Sampoerna U in Indonesia, and Fortune and Jackpot in the Philippines. PMI's smoke-free innovations are currently available across 71 global markets. Established in 1987, Philip Morris International Inc. is headquartered in New York, New York.
